**Installation:**
|
|
|
|
- AlbiDOS can be installed in ROM number slot 7 for maximum compatibility (some old softwares are relying directly on ROM#7 to handle i/o instead of using system-friendly way). In that case you should install AMSDOS to slot #15 to ensure its memory allocation is always &A700 (also for maximum compatibility).
|
|
|
|
- Please note than ParaDOS cannot be installed in slot 15 (it will crash). If you want to use AlbiDOS and ParaDOS together your are stuck with ParaDOS as ROM#7 (better) or #6 and AlbiDOS somewere between #1 and #6.
|
|
|
|
- AlbiDOS can work in any ROM slot but should always be in a slot with a lower number than AMSDOS (for a better user experience !).
|
|
|
|
- AlbiDOS can work in two different modes (the current mode is displayed at boot screen):
|
|
|
|
- Integrated: AMSDOS was found in a higher slot number and all fallback and compatibility mecanism are installed.
|
|
|
|
- Standalone: AMSDOS was not found an AlbiDOS will just handle Albireo drives (no fallback is possible).
